Top 20 Bike Parks around Bodelshausen

Best bike parks around Bodelshausen include a notable new mountain bike circuit, the Bike Park Bodelshausen. This facility offers diverse course elements such as a cross-country track, jump hills, ramps, and steep curves. For enduro enthusiasts, the park integrates obstacles like stone fields, horizontal logs, and rock passages. The broader region also provides numerous mountain bike trails, catering to various riding preferences.

Frequently Asked Questions

What kind of features can I expect at Bike Park Bodelshausen?

Bike Park Bodelshausen offers a variety of features, including a cross-country track, jump hills, ramps, and steep curves. For enduro riders, there are integrated obstacles like stone fields, horizontal logs, bridges, and rock passages. It was designed by a former German Downhill Champion, ensuring a challenging and enjoyable experience.

Is there a local cycling club that offers activities or training?

Yes, the Radsportverein Bodelshausen (Bodelshausen Cycling Club) is active in the area. They promote mountain biking and offer guided tours, technical training on self-built obstacles, and excursions to trails in nearby regions like Albstadt and Freiburg.
